Drake and Rick Ross‘ feud continues on social media through direct messages, memes, and photos. 

The two have moved on from their past collaborations and are slamming each other about airplanes and properties. The beef began over the weekend following Drake’s release of his diss track, “Push Ups,” which mentions Rick Ross, among other rappers. Ross unfollowed Drake a couple of weeks ago over a cease-and-desist letter sent to French Montana

Within hours, Ross responded to “Push Ups” with his diss track “Champagne Moments.” According to Mal of the New Rory and Mal Podcast, Drake initially turned off “Champagne Moments” after Ross raps that he is richer. Celebrity Net Worth reports Drake has a net worth of $250 million, while Rick Ross has a net worth of $150 million.

Following the release of diss tracks, Ross continued to talk about Drake on various social media platforms, such as Instagram Live and comment sections of popular accounts and even added  “Champagne Moments” on streaming services. Akademiks posted a screenshot of Drake mocking Ross’ wealth on Instagram, which prompted Ross to respond with a challenge a few minutes later.

Birdman and Ross are rivals, while Drake has Birdman’s support. Lil Wayne, DJ Khaled, Meek Mill, and French Montana – Drake and Ross’s acquaintances – haven’t taken a side. 

Ross has been trying to get Drake to join social media banter but Drake has not responded. Ross urged Drake to buy Birdman another mansion using his wealth in a mocking tone. He gave Drake a 48-hour deadline to respond and also made a sarcastic comment about Drake’s old jet.

Ross and Drake have collaborated and reached number one on the Billboard charts with “Stay Schemin” in 2012, before the beef. Drake has not responded to “Champagne Moments” yet. 

Drake also feuds with Future, Kendrick Lamar, Metro Boomin, A$AP Rocky, The Weeknd, and basketball star Ja Morant.
